The future of the eugenol market looks promising with opportunities in the food and beverages industry, animal feed, chemical industry, pharmaceuticals, personal care, agriculture, and others. The global Eugenol market is expected to grow with a CAGR of 7%-9% from 2020 to 2025. The major drivers for this market are increasing demand for convenience food and technological innovations, and production of Eugenol from cost effective renewable sources are other factors driving the market growth.

Some of the eugenol companies profiled in this report include Van Aroma, Nile Chemicals, Sigma-Aldrich, Nusaroma Indonesia Essential Oil, Berj?, CV. Indaroma, Extrasynthese, Penta Manufacturing Company, Vigon International, and Boc Sciences.

In this market, cloves, cinnamon, nutmeg, basil, and others are the major product types. Lucintel forecasts that cloves will remain the largest segment over the forecast period because owing to its potent anti-stress and neuro-protective properties properties, is a significant growth attribute for the market.

Within this market, perfumeries, flavorings, essential oils, medicine, plastics and rubber, production of isoeugenol, and others are the major application of eugenol. Medicine will remain the largest segment by application type over the forecast period due to increased consumer demand for is being viewed as an effective therapeutic tool, which can be incorporated in various food products and herbal medicines to contend considerable metabolic disorders. On account of its significant antimicrobial properties, eugenol seeks application in inhibiting growth of the microbial populations in several food products.

Asia-Pacific is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period due to its mainly attributed to surging prevalence of ailments such as diabetes, and cancer, and growing revenues from end-use of eugenol in personal care products.
